Epimediums have been popular in Japan for many years but are now increasing in popularity in Britain. They are generally hardy and thrive in dappled shade in moist, well-drained soil, bring light to a shady broder.
Epimedium x perralchicum is a pretty, but robust barrenwort, forming a large clump of glossy, heart-shaped deep green leaves, which are flushed bronze in spring and autumn. Tiny pendent, bright yellow flowers appear on delicate wiry stems, from mid- to late-spring. Epimedium x perralchicum is ideal for growing beneath deciduous trees, and makes excellent ground cover.
For the best foliage, cut back old leaves in spring before new leaves appear.

Epimedium perralchicum and wildlife
Epimedium perralchicum has no particular known value to wildlife in the UK.
Is Epimedium perralchicum poisonous?
Epimedium perralchicum has no toxic effects reported.
